Labor Day morning was shattered by a tragic accident that claimed the life of Daniel Murphy. Just after 3:20 a.m., emergency responders arrived at the intersection of Seventh Street and Federation Drive, where they found Murphy unconscious on the roadway. 


According to reports, Murphy, 45 years old, had been riding his scooter southbound when he was struck outside a marked crosswalk near Recreation Park. Witnesses described hearing the impact and seeing Murphy lying motionless on the street, prompting immediate paramedic response.

Paramedics worked swiftly to stabilize Murphy at the scene, employing life-saving measures before rushing him to a nearby hospital. Despite their best efforts, Murphy succumbed to his injuries later that morning. 

The loss has left the community grieving and underscores the dangers faced by vulnerable street users, especially during the early morning hours when visibility is limited and traffic may be sparse.

Authorities confirmed that the vehicle involved was a 2016 Hyundai Accent driven by a 28-year-old man from Laguna Beach. 

The driver remained at the scene and cooperated fully with investigators. Initial assessments indicated that the driver was operating within legal speed limits and was not under the influence of alcohol or drugs at the time of the crash. 

Authorities have stated that neither speed, alcohol consumption, nor phone use appeared to be contributing factors in the collision, though the investigation remains ongoing.

Law enforcement officials are calling on the public to assist with the investigation. They are urging witnesses or anyone with relevant information to come forward to help clarify the circumstances leading up to the collision.
